Cobwebs

By Young, Karen

Publishers Summary:
Sixteen-year-old Nancy enjoys the colorful ethnic mix of her heritage in several different Brooklyn households, not suspecting how very strange that heritage is.

REVIEWS

School Library Journal

Reviewed on January 1, 2005

Gr 7-Up Sixteen-year-old Nancy's family is odd. It's not that her mother is white and her father is black -she lives in New York, where biracial families are not uncommon. It's not even that her mother, a master weaver, is agoraphobic, or that her father moves out of their basement apartment every spring to live on a nearby rooftop. It's that her father produces sticky silk threads from his hands to help him travel Brooklyn by rooftop, and her mother comes from a line of powerful healers.
